"""Test cases for the fnmatch module."""
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
from test import support
 | 
						|
import unittest
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
from fnmatch import fnmatch, fnmatchcase
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
class FnmatchTestCase(unittest.TestCase):
 | 
						|
    def check_match(self, filename, pattern, should_match=1):
 | 
						|
        if should_match:
 | 
						|
            self.assert_(fnmatch(filename, pattern),
 | 
						|
                         "expected %r to match pattern %r"
 | 
						|
                         % (filename, pattern))
 | 
						|
        else:
 | 
						|
            self.assert_(not fnmatch(filename, pattern),
 | 
						|
                         "expected %r not to match pattern %r"
 | 
						|
                         % (filename, pattern))
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    def test_fnmatch(self):
 | 
						|
        check = self.check_match
 | 
						|
        check('abc', 'abc')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', '?*?')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', '???*')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', '*???')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', '???')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', '*')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', 'ab[cd]')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', 'ab[!de]')
 | 
						|
        check('abc', 'ab[de]', 0)
 | 
						|
        check('a', '??', 0)
 | 
						|
        check('a', 'b', 0)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        # these test that '\' is handled correctly in character sets;
 | 
						|
        # see SF bug #???
 | 
						|
        check('\\', r'[\]')
 | 
						|
        check('a', r'[!\]')
 | 
						|
        check('\\', r'[!\]', 0)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
def test_main():
 | 
						|
    support.run_unittest(FnmatchTestCase)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
if __name__ == "__main__":
 | 
						|
    test_main()
